Each product has a narrative. From the uncooked supplies used to create it, to the power it consumes, to the place it finally ends up when it’s now not helpful— every stage impacts the surroundings. Life Cycle Assessments, or LCAs, assist us estimate that impression and determine areas for enchancment all through a product’s life cycle.
LCAs assist companies perceive the environmental footprint of their merchandise, processes, or providers throughout each stage of their life cycle. From power use to water consumption, LCAs reveal important information that may drive extra sustainable selections.
What’s a Life Cycle Evaluation (LCA)?
A Life Cycle Evaluation evaluates the complete life cycle of a product, together with*:
- Uncooked materials extraction. One instance is sourcing minerals, metals, or pure fibers.
- Supplies and product manufacturing — corresponding to changing supplies into completed merchandise.
- Transportation and distribution — together with the journey to shops, warehouses, and prospects.
- Utilization — corresponding to sources consumed when a product is in use.
- Finish-of-life — what occurs to a product after use: as an example, recycling, reuse, or landfill disposal.
LCAs estimate the environmental impression at every stage, offering an image of a product’s footprint. Companies depend on LCAs to determine the place the best impacts happen and discover alternatives to scale back their environmental impression.
* Be aware, the examples listed above should not exhaustive and are supposed to be illustrative.
What do LCAs estimate?
LCAs transcend simply evaluating a product’s carbon footprint to incorporate subjects corresponding to water consumption, power demand, useful resource depletion, waste era, and air pollution. Let’s take the instance of a seemingly easy T-shirt to discover an instance of what could be measured:
World Warming Potential (GWP): LCAs estimate the greenhouse gases like carbon dioxide (CO₂) and methane (CH₄) that contribute to local weather change. For a T-shirt, these emissions happen at each stage—from producing cotton to powering factories and transporting the completed product.
Blue Water Consumption (Water utilization): LCAs estimate how a lot contemporary water is consumed throughout manufacturing and product use. For instance, producing sufficient cotton for a single T-shirt can require 1000’s of liters of water, with further water used for dyeing, washing, and cleansing the shirt over its lifetime.
Major Power Demand (Power consumption): LCAs consider the power sources used to provide, distribute, and energy a product. For a T-shirt, this contains operating textile equipment in factories and transporting the shirt across the globe.
Ecotoxicity (Waste and air pollution): LCAs estimate pollution that have an effect on air, water, and land. In T-shirt manufacturing, chemical dyes and by merchandise can probably pollute water sources, and the shirt itself might finally find yourself in a landfill.
Abiotic Depletion Potential (Useful resource depletion): LCAs estimate using finite sources like metals, minerals, and fossil fuels. In our T-shirt instance, rising cotton depletes soil vitamins, whereas producing artificial fibers like polyester depends on fossil fuels.
By capturing this full vary of environmental impacts, LCAs empower companies to prioritize extra sustainable actions throughout their operations and product design.
Why LCAs matter for companies
LCAs is usually a highly effective instrument for driving innovation and lowering environmental impression.
They’ll supply tangible advantages for companies aiming to fulfill their sustainability objectives. By figuring out probably the most resource-intensive phases of a product’s life, corporations can goal environmental “hotspots” and implement modifications corresponding to utilizing renewable power to energy manufacturing websites or switching to extra sustainable supplies that cut back their total impression. These insights can drive innovation, enabling the design of merchandise which are extra energy-efficient, sturdy, and round with diminished resource-intensiveness and environmental impression.
For instance, it’s estimated that over 80% of product-related environmental impacts are decided throughout the design part.1 LCAs might help examine options and perceive trade-offs when choosing elements, course of steps or disposal sorts. By integrating LCAs early within the design course of, corporations can enhance sustainability outcomes.
Publishing LCA outcomes helps to reinforce company transparency and help environmental reporting. Sharing these studies builds belief with prospects, staff, traders, and different stakeholders, whereas guaranteeing compliance with international sustainability requirements and reporting frameworks.
How are LCAs performed?
Conducting an LCA is a structured course of that includes gathering information throughout each part of the product lifecycle, assessing environmental impacts, and deciphering the outcomes to help initiatives like net-zero objectives and round product design.
LCAs observe globally accepted requirements, such because the Worldwide Group for Standardization’s (ISO) 14040 and 14044. There are different requirements which are additionally based mostly on ISO’s framework.
Cisco’s method to Life Cycle Assessments
At Cisco, LCAs play a key function in our efforts to estimate and reduce the environmental impression of our merchandise.
Lately, we introduced that Cisco has made these assessments publicly obtainable, sharing LCAs for a variety of our merchandise on the Sustainability Assets part of our web site. Cisco has already accomplished 23 LCAs throughout 8 enterprise items prior to now two years and plans to publish further assessments throughout key product strains in 2025. Sharing these outcomes helps transparency and demonstrates our dedication to measurable progress.
Whereas many know-how corporations publish LCAs, Cisco is among the first to provide them for networking tools, corresponding to Catalyst switches. Cisco’s Chief Sustainability Workplace and Provide Chain Sustainability groups proceed to accomplice with our colleagues throughout the corporate to provide these studies, and we plan to proceed publishing them as they grow to be obtainable.
LCAs are a part of how we method sustainability holistically. LCA information helps our round design technique— to develop merchandise and sources which are reused, repurposed, and stored in circulation for so long as doable. By evaluating the whole lot from materials sourcing to end-of-life disposal, we acquire important insights that information our product design and innovation.
